Crescent Streusel Strip

Prep: 10 min Cook: 16 min Serves: 12 Cuisine: American

Crescent streusel strips offer a delightful combination of flaky dough, cinnamon-sugar filling, and crunchy nuts, perfect for breakfast or a sweet snack enjoyed by all ages.

Be the first to rate this recipe

Ingredients

  • 8 oz. refrigerated crescent dough
  • 1/2 tsp. cinnamon
  • 1/3 c. brown sugar
  • 1/4 c. flour
  • 1/4 c. butter, softened
  • 1/3 c. finely ground pecans or walnuts

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Unroll the refrigerated crescent dough onto an ungreased cookie sheet, forming two long rectangles.
  3. Overlap the long sides of the rectangles by 1/2 inch and press edges and perforations to seal.
  4. Roll the dough to form a 13 x 19-inch rectangle.
  5. In a small bowl, combine brown sugar, flour, and cinnamon.
  6. Blend in softened butter until well mixed.
  7. Spread the brown sugar mixture over half of the lengthwise dough, leaving a 1/2-inch border.
  8. Sprinkle ground pecans or walnuts over the sugar spread.
  9. Fold the dough in half lengthwise over the filling, pressing edges with a fork to seal.
  10. Brush the top with milk and sprinkle with additional brown sugar.
  11. Bake for 16 to 20 minutes, until golden brown.
  12. Cool for 10 minutes before slicing into strips and serving.
